Human services
Bastrop County Emergency Food Pantry
The pantry offers a variety of programs to address food insecurity, including food assistance for adults, children and seniors, as well as educational workshops on budgeting, meal planning, smart shopping, nutrition and more.
- Sample activities: food pickup, storage packaging and delivery; administrative assistance; buildings and grounds maintenance; food drive assistance; senior activity support
- Donations: monetary donations online; nonperishable food items such as canned meats, vegetables and fruit, cornbread mix, Hamburger Helper, sugar, flour, cooking oil, and juices; and hygiene items such as toothpaste, shampoo, laundry detergent and toilet tissue

Bastrop County Master Gardener Association
The volunteer-led organization is dedicated to promoting sustainable gardening and environmental stewardship throughout the community.
- Sample activities: volunteer days from 5-6 p.m. on Mondays and Wednesdays and from 8-10 a.m. on Saturdays at Bob Bryant Park, as well as from 9-11 a.m. on Fridays at Cedar Creek Park.
- Donations: monetary donations online

Bastrop County Animal Services
The shelter provides a safe home for homeless dogs and cats, and facilitates adoptions through in-person visits and adoption events, contingent on an approved application. Volunteers must be 18 years old or 14 with parental supervision.
- Sample activities: cleaning kennels, walking dogs, or socializing cats; providing adoption assistance or administrative support; helping with event organization
- Donations: pet supplies such as crates, beds, wet and dry food, cat litter, treats, and toys; cleaning supplies such as bleach, trash bags and liquid soap; and other items such as blankets and towels
